Understanding the Payment Landscape in Bitcoin Casinos

One of the biggest appeals of bitcoin casinos lies in their payment methods. Unlike traditional deposit systems, Bitcoin transactions can bypass banks and intermediaries, offering near-instantaneous transfers. This is a huge advantage for players who don’t want to wait days for withdrawals. But it’s not all black and white — Bitcoin’s price volatility and transaction fees can impact the overall experience.

Many bitcoin casinos also accept other cryptocurrencies like Ethereum or Litecoin, but Bitcoin remains dominant. These payments are secured by blockchain technology, which adds a layer of transparency and security absent in some fiat transactions. That said, not every casino handles these processes the same way, and it’s essential to look for platforms that prioritize user protection through SSL encryption and comply with relevant regulations. Popular Games and Providers in Crypto Casinos

When it comes to gameplay, the presence of acclaimed providers like NetEnt and Play’n GO in bitcoin casinos speaks volumes about the quality available. Slots such as Starburst and Book of Dead have found their way into many crypto platforms, offering familiar thrills with the added layer of cryptocurrency betting. Live dealer games from Evolution Gaming also enhance the experience, blending real-time interaction with the benefits of crypto payments.

RTP (Return to Player) rates in these casinos often mirror those of traditional platforms, hovering around 96% or higher for popular slots. This suggests that players aren’t sacrificing fairness by switching to Bitcoin-based gambling. Still, the decentralized nature of many bitcoin casinos means some smaller operators might offer provably fair games as a selling point, a feature that allows players to verify game outcomes independently – an intriguing twist on trust and transparency.

Practical Tips to Avoid Common Pitfalls in Bitcoin Casinos

Getting started with bitcoin casinos isn’t without its challenges. From my experience, one of the most common mistakes is overlooking the importance of licenses and regulation. Just because a casino accepts Bitcoin doesn’t guarantee it operates fairly or securely.

Here are a few practical tips to keep in mind:

  1. Check for valid gambling licenses from reputable jurisdictions such as Curacao or Malta.
  2. Prioritize platforms with clear terms of service and transparent withdrawal limits.
  3. Be wary of casinos with poor or no customer support.
  4. Understand the volatility risk of Bitcoin and never gamble more than you can afford to lose.
  5. Look for provably fair games if transparency is a priority for you.

These steps can save you from unnecessary headaches and potential losses. Remember, bitcoin casinos are still a relatively new frontier, and prudence is essential when stepping into this space.
